warped bottom isn't appreciated Feb 24, 2009
By P. Middleton I recently purchased this skillet and was surprised to find that each time it gets hot (just past medium) the bottom of the pan warps. It rocks badly on my glass top stove. Then when it cools, it goes back to flat. More annoying than anything as things seem to cook just fine.
